func TestValidateNetworkCreate(t *testing.T) {
yes := true
no := false
//DeleteNetworks
cases := []NetworkValidationTestCase{
NetworkValidationTestCase{
testname: "InvalidAddress",
network: models.Network{
AddressRange: "10.0.0.256",
NetID: "skynet",
IsDualStack: &no,
},
errMessage: "Field validation for 'AddressRange' failed on the 'cidr' tag",
},
NetworkValidationTestCase{
testname: "BadDisplayName",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"skynet",
DisplayName: "skynet*",
IsDualStack: &no,
},
errMessage: "Field validation for 'DisplayName' failed on the 'alphanum' tag",
},
NetworkValidationTestCase{
testname: "DisplayNameTooLong",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"skynet",
DisplayName: "Thisisareallylongdisplaynamethatistoolong",
IsDualStack: &no,
},
errMessage: "Field validation for 'DisplayName' failed on the 'max' tag",
},
NetworkValidationTestCase{
testname: "DisplayNameTooShort",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"skynet",
DisplayName: "1",
IsDualStack: &no,
},
errMessage: "Field validation for 'DisplayName' failed on the 'min' tag",
},
NetworkValidationTestCase{
testname: "NetIDMissing",
network: models.Network{
AddressRange: "10.0.0.1/24",
IsDualStack: &no,
},
errMessage: "Field validation for 'NetID' failed on the 'required' tag",
},
NetworkValidationTestCase{
testname: "InvalidNetID",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"contains spaces",
IsDualStack: &no,
},
errMessage: "Field validation for 'NetID' failed on the 'alphanum' tag",
},
NetworkValidationTestCase{
testname: "NetIDTooShort",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"",
IsDualStack: &no,
},
errMessage: "Field validation for 'NetID' failed on the 'required' tag",
},
NetworkValidationTestCase{
testname: "NetIDTooLong",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"LongNetIDName",
IsDualStack: &no,
},
errMessage: "Field validation for 'NetID' failed on the 'max' tag",
},
NetworkValidationTestCase{
testname: "ListenPortTooLow",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"skynet",
DefaultListenPort: 1023,
IsDualStack: &no,
},
errMessage: "Field validation for 'DefaultListenPort' failed on the 'min' tag",
},
NetworkValidationTestCase{
testname: "ListenPortTooHigh",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"skynet",
DefaultListenPort: 65536,
IsDualStack: &no,
},
errMessage: "Field validation for 'DefaultListenPort' failed on the 'max' tag",
},
NetworkValidationTestCase{
testname: "KeepAliveTooBig",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"skynet",
DefaultKeepalive: 1010,
IsDualStack: &no,
},
errMessage: "Field validation for 'DefaultKeepalive' failed on the 'max' tag",
},
NetworkValidationTestCase{
testname: "InvalidLocalRange",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"skynet",
LocalRange: "192.168.0.1",
IsDualStack: &no,
},
errMessage: "Field validation for 'LocalRange' failed on the 'cidr' tag",
},
NetworkValidationTestCase{
testname: "DualStackWithoutIPv6",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"skynet",
IsDualStack: &yes,
},
errMessage: "Field validation for 'AddressRange6' failed on the 'addressrange6_valid' tag",
},
NetworkValidationTestCase{
testname: "CheckInIntervalTooBig",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"skynet",
IsDualStack: &no,
DefaultCheckInInterval: 100001,
},
errMessage: "Field validation for 'DefaultCheckInInterval' failed on the 'max' tag",
},
NetworkValidationTestCase{
testname: "CheckInIntervalTooSmall",
network: models.Network{
AddressRange: "10.0.0.1/24",
NetID: "skynet",
IsDualStack: &no,
DefaultCheckInInterval: 1,
},
errMessage: "Field validation for 'DefaultCheckInInterval' failed on the 'min' tag",
},
}
for _, tc := range cases {
t.Run(tc.testname, func(t *testing.T) {
err := ValidateNetworkCreate(tc.network)
assert.NotNil(t, err)
assert.Contains(t, err.Error(), tc.errMessage)
})
}
t.Run("DuplicateNetID", func(t *testing.T) {
var net1, net2 models.Network
net1.NetID = "skylink"
net1.AddressRange = "10.0.0.1/24"
net1.DisplayName = "mynetwork"
net2.NetID = "skylink"
net2.AddressRange = "10.0.1.1/24"
net2.IsDualStack = &no
err := CreateNetwork(net1)
assert.Nil(t, err)
err = ValidateNetworkCreate(net2)
assert.NotNil(t, err)
assert.Contains(t, err.Error(), "Field validation for 'NetID' failed on the 'netid_valid' tag")
})
t.Run("DuplicateDisplayName", func(t *testing.T) {
var network models.Network
network.NetID = "wirecat"
network.AddressRange = "10.0.100.1/24"
network.IsDualStack = &no
network.DisplayName = "mynetwork"
err := ValidateNetworkCreate(network)
assert.NotNil(t, err)
assert.Contains(t, err.Error(), "Field validation for 'DisplayName' failed on the 'displayname_unique' tag")
})
}
